CONGRATS to all newly admitted medical school, u've finally conquered d rigorous admission process in dis country. Here are some important things you need to know b4 u start this journey: Simple enough, here are 50 things you wish you knew before starting medical school. 1. If I had known what it was going to be like, I would never have done it. 2. You’ll study more than you ever have in your life. 3. Only half of your class will be in the top 50%. You have a 50% chance of being in the top half of your class. Get used to it now. 4. You don’t need to know anatomy before school starts. Or pathology. Or physiology. 5. Third year rotations will suck the life out you. 6. Several people from your class will have intimate relationships with each other. You might be one of the lucky participants. 7. You may discover early on that medicine isn’t for you. 8. You don’t have to be AOA or have impeccable board scores to match somewhere – only if you’re matching into radiology. 9. Your social life may suffer some. 10. Pelvic exams are teh suck. 11. You won’t be a medical student on the surgery service. You’ll be the retractor bitch. 12. Residents will probably ask you to retrieve some type of nourishment for them. 13. Most of your time on rotations will be wasted. Thrown away. Down the drain. 14. You’ll work with at least one attending physician who you’ll want to beat the shit out of. 15. You’ll work with at least three residents who you’ll want to beat the shit out of. 16. You’ll ask a stranger about the quality of their stools. 17. You’ll ask post- op patients if they’ve farted within the last 24 hours. 18. At some point during your stay, a stranger’s bodily fluids will most likely come into contact with your exposed skin. 19. Somebody in your class will flunk out of medical school. 20. You’ll work 14 days straight without a single day off. Probably multiple times. 1 Like |

21. A student in your class will have intimate relationships with an attending or resident. 22. After the first two years are over, your summer breaks will no longer exist. Enjoy them as much as you can. 23. You’ll be sleep deprived. 24. There will be times on certain rotations where you won’t be allowed to eat. 25. You will be pimped. 26. You’ll wake up one day and ask yourself is this really what you want out of life. 27. You’ll party a lot during the first two years, but then that pretty much ends at the beginning of your junior year. 28. You’ll probably change your specialty of choice at least 4 times. 29. You’ll spend a good deal of your time playing social worker. 30. You’ll learn that medical insurance reimbursement is a huge problem, particularly for primary care physicians. 31. Nurses will treat you badly, simply because you are a medical student. 32. There will be times when you’ll be ignored by your attending or resident. 33. You will develop a thick skin. If you fail to do this, you’ll cry often. 34. Public humiliation is very commonplace in medical training. 35. Surgeons are assholes. Take my word for it now. 36. OB/GYN residents are treated like shit, and that shit runs downhill. Be ready to pick it up and sleep with it. 37. It’s always the medical student’s fault. 38. Gunner is a derogatory word. It’s almost as bad as racial slurs. 39. You’ll look forward to the weekend, not so you can relax and have a good time but so you can catch up on studying for the week. 40. Your house might go uncleaned for two weeks during an intensive exam block. 41. As a medical student on rotations, you don’t matter. In fact, you get in the way and impede productivity. 42. There’s a fair chance that you will be physically struck by a nurse, resident, or attending physician. This may include slapped on the hand or kicked on the shin in order to instruct you to “move” or “get out of the way.” 43. Any really bad procedures will be done by you. The residents don’t want to do them, and you’re the low man on the totem pole. This includes rectal examinations and digital disimpactions. 44. You’ll be competing against the best of the best, the cream of the crop. This isn’t college where half of your classmates are idiots. Everybody in medical school is smart. 45. Don’t think that you own the world because you just got accepted into medical school. That kind of attitude will humble you faster than anything else. 46. If you’re in it for the money, there are much better, more efficient ways to make a living. Medicine is not one of them. 47. Anatomy sucks. All of the bone names sound the same. 48. If there is anything at all that you’d rather do in life, do not go into medicine. 49. The competition doesn’t end after getting accepted to medical school. You’ll have to compete for class rank, awards, and residency. If you want to do a fellowship, you’ll have to compete for that too. 50. You’ll never look at weekends the same again. 6 Likes |
